If you’ve ever watched a movie or TV show where a character throws around stacks of cash, you may have wondered if they are real bills. The truth is, most of the time they are not real money, but rather prop money.
Prop money is used in the entertainment industry as a safe and legal alternative to real currency. It is often used in scenes where large amounts of money are needed, like in a bank robbery or drug deal.
Five dollar bills are a popular option for prop money because they are small and easy to handle. However, it’s essential to note that prop money 5 dollar bills look incredibly realistic and should never be passed off as real money.
The production of prop money is highly regulated to prevent counterfeit bills from entering circulation. Prop money is usually printed with the words “FOR MOTION PICTURE USE ONLY” clearly visible on the front and back of the bills.
If you’re a collector interested in owning prop money, you can purchase it online, but it comes with strict guidelines. You must agree not to use it for any illegal purpose or try to pass it off as real currency.
